Should I give a statement to the Insurance company of the person that hit me?

No. You should not communicate with the at-fault party’s insurance carrier in a personal injury case until you have consulted with an attorney. Doing so may result in you accidentally hurting what would otherwise be a strong claim.

What is a wrongful death claim?

A wrongful death lawsuit alleges the decedent was killed as a result of negligence on the part of a third party, and that the surviving dependents or beneficiaries are entitled to monetary damages as a result of the defendant’s conduct. A surviving spouse, children, beneficiaries or dependents are the only persons who can make a wrongful death claim.

What are some signs of nursing home neglect?

There are several signs that may indicate your loved one is being abused or neglected in their nursing home. Do they appear to have low self-esteem? Are there visible signs of bed sores, bruising, weight loss or weight gain? Are they taking medication that wasn’t prescribed by a family physician? These are only a few indications of potential nursing home abuse and neglect.
